I liked the idea of the Ol'Tom Cassanova. Like some of you, I have struggled with the portability of the b-mobile and the ease of use for the pretty-boy. The Ol'Tom Cassanova seemed to have both aspects. However, the tail was attached using six buttons. (I found the same decoy under a different name at Dick's Sporting Goods. It was called Lodge Outfitters Combo. It was the hen and Cassanova for $70.)
Anyway, I compared all three in the store. The Cassanova is more flexible than the b-mobile. The only problem was that the tail attachement buttoned on with six pesky buttons. I couldn't imagine trying to do it in a hurry or in the dark. That's when the idea hit me. VELCRO.
I went to Wal-Mart and bought some heavy duty velcro with heavy duty adhesive.
Check it out.
This thing folds up tighter than the b-mobile and NOW has the ease of setup as the prettyboy.
